Rudrapur

Rudrapur is a village located in Biloli tehsil of Nanded district in Maharashtra, India. It is situated 11km away from sub-district headquarter Biloli (tehsildar office) and 75km away from district headquarter Nanded. As per 2009 stats, Rudrapur village is also a gram panchayat.

About Rudrapur

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Rudrapur is 545086. The village spans a total geographical area of 460 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 431710. Biloli is nearest town to Rudrapur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 11km away.

When it comes to local governance, Rudrapur village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Deglur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Nanded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Rudrapur

Below is a concise population overview of Rudrapur as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 1,744 860 884
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 283 135 148
Scheduled Castes (SC) 243 124 119
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 35 18 17
Literate Population 893 529 364
Illiterate Population 851 331 520

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Rudrapur village:

  • The total population of Rudrapur village is around 1,744, including approximately 860 males and 884 females, with a sex ratio of 1027 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 283 children aged 0–6 years in Rudrapur village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Rudrapur village has 243 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 35 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Rudrapur village is about 51.20%, with male literacy at 61.51% and female literacy at 41.18%.
  • There are around 360 households in Rudrapur village.

Connectivity of Rudrapur

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Rudrapur. As per the 2011 stats, Rudrapur had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
